Amazon.com essential video: Let's see--he's been Han Solo in three films and Indiana Jones in three more. So why shouldn't Harrison Ford take on a new continuing character in Tom Clancy's CIA analyst Jack Ryan? In this film, directed by Phillip Noyce, Ford picked up the baton when Alec Baldwin, who played Ryan in The Hunt for Red October, opted for a Broadway role instead. In this film, Ryan and his family are on vacation when Ryan saves a member of the British royal family from attack by Irish terrorists. The next thing he knows, the Ryan clan has been targeted by the same terrorists, who invade his Maryland home. The film can't shed all of Clancy's lumbering prose, or his techno-dweeb fascination with spy satellites and the like. But no one is better than Ford at righteous heroism--and Sean Bean makes a suitably snakey villain. --Marshall Fine

I've seen this movie a number of times, and it is a very good adaptation of Tom Clancy's novel. There is some violence, but it is not gratuitous or over the top as in many movies. However, as a number of reviewers have noted, the quality of the video in this Blu-Ray disc leaves a lot to be desired (thus 4 stars instead of 5). Although I did not see exactly the same problems that other reviewers saw, there were intermittent vertical ghost lines throughout the movie. It is not terribly distracting, and my wife says she would not have noticed had I not commented on it, but in my opinion, there is just no excuse for this less than optimal video. When you pay the premium for Blu-Ray, you should get top-notch video quality. Nevertheless, the movie itself is well worth watching.
